		<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>We now have more evidence that the Bush Administration politicized intelligence in the run-up to the Iraq War.  Paul R. Pillar was National Intelligence Officer for the Middle East and South Asia from 2001-2005, and was responsible for coordinating all of the intelligence communy&#8217;s assessments regarding Iraq.  He writes in the online version of Foreign Affairs that the intelligence was politicized and cherry-picked, particularly with regard to the supposed link between Saddam Hussein and Aa-Qaeda.  The article is at: <a href="http://www.foreignaffairs.org/20060301faessay85202-p10/paul-r-pillar/intelligence-policy-and-the-war-in-iraq.html" rel="nofollow">http://www.foreignaffairs.org/20060301faessay85202-p10/paul-r-pillar/intelligence-policy-and-the-war-in-iraq.html</a><br />
   This article agrees with the statement of former British Foreign Secretary Robin Cook on June 17, 2003: &#8220;&#8230;instead of using intelligence as evidence on which to base a decision about policy, we used intelligence as the basies on which to justify a policy on which we had already settled.&#8221;  There was a similar statement in the Downing Street Memo: &#8220;&#8230;the intelligence and facts were being fixed around the policy.&#8221;  Three insider accounts, all with the same conclusion.</p>
